S.B. No. 58
Session Year 2025
 


AN ACT AUTHORIZING RESIDENTS LIVING IN A FLOOD ZONE TO LAY UP TO TEN THOUSAND CUBIC YARDS OF LANDSCAPE FILL PER YEAR IN THEIR YARD AND ESTABLISHING A TAX DEDUCTION FOR THE COSTS OF SUCH FILL AND A GRANT PROGRAM FOR ROAD RAISING.

To authorize the placement of landscape fill in flood zones and create a tax deduction for such flood prevention measures as well as a grant program for road raising municipalities climate resiliency efforts by municipalities.

Introduced by:
Environment Committee
